You can't get a Class A boss until at LEAST floor 6 and even then it's rare. It's more common on floor 7+. So do not leave if you don't get it on the first floor.

 

And if you've killed at least 1 boss AND you get a boss you don't want to kill, just loot the rewards chest on that floor instead of going down the chain. That resets the floor without having to leave.

 

That means the only time you should be doing what you're doing is if you get a very annoying high-class (but not class A) boss on floor 1, which is very unlikely and only happened to me once or twice getting 500 kills.

Yes that is what freestyle is for unfortunately doing the various unlocks in the tower requires specific lists of bosses to be killed and these bosses can ONLY be killed in endurance or climber for it to count AND are not unlocked in freestyle until you kill them in endurance or climber. (The exception being Nomad who can be done via his special)
